Outback was always one of my favourite mini-bots back in the G1 days,so i thought i would give him a Movie update.
I based his vehicle mode on the Scorpion Desert Patrol vehicle with a TOW missile launcher.
Used Movie brawls head & made a few minor re-sculpts.
All other parts were from a Jeep kit wich happend to have the Tow launcher on it.
Outback was painted with Games workshop paints (Mainly Bubonic Brown,Dark flesh,Dwarf Bronze & boltgun metal)
